Tempus AI, Inc. (NASDAQ: TEM), a dynamic player in the healthcare technology sector, is capturing investor attention with its strong revenue growth and strategic collaborations. Head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, this innovative company specializes in health information services, offering a comprehensive suite of biomedical data analytics and diagnostic services that are reshaping the healthcare landscape.

With a robust market capitalization of $10.82 billion, Tempus AI has positioned itself as a formidable force in the industry. Its pioneering Tempus platform integrates laboratory diagnostics with a clinician’s desktop, offering a seamless, data-driven approach to healthcare. The platform’s capabilities are further enhanced by its Hub application, enabling end-to-end diagnostics for healthcare providers, and its Lens software for life sciences and precision research.

Despite its promising technology, Tempus AI is navigating a complex financial landscape. The current stock price of $60.27 reflects a slight downturn, with a price change of -1.33 (-0.02%). Investors should note the company’s 52-week price range of $42.37 to $103.25, highlighting its historical volatility and potential for substantial price swings.

The valuation metrics present a mixed picture. With a Forward P/E ratio of -565.01, the company is not currently profitable on a per-share basis, which is typical for firms heavily investing in growth and innovation. The absence of a trailing P/E ratio, PEG ratio, and other traditional valuation metrics suggests that Tempus AI is in a rapid development phase, prioritizing long-term strategic goals over immediate profitability.

Performance metrics underscore the company’s growth trajectory with an impressive revenue growth rate of 36.10%. However, challenges persist, as indicated by a negative EPS of -1.72 and a substantial negative return on equity of -81.58%. These figures point to ongoing investments and potential operational inefficiencies that the company must address to achieve sustainable profitability.

Tempus AI does not currently offer dividends, aligning with its strategy of reinvesting profits to fuel growth. The company’s strategic partnerships with industry giants like AstraZeneca, GlaxoSmithKline, and Merck further bolster its growth prospects, providing access to cutting-edge research and development resources.

Analyst ratings for Tempus AI reveal a cautiously optimistic sentiment. With 10 buy ratings, 7 hold ratings, and a single sell rating, analysts see potential for growth. The average target price of $66.06 suggests a potential upside of 9.61%, a compelling prospect for investors willing to embrace the inherent risks associated with a high-growth technology company.

Technical indicators are crucial for investors evaluating entry and exit points. Tempus AI’s 50-day moving average of 50.66 suggests a positive short-term trend, while the 200-day moving average of 63.08 indicates a longer-term bearish sentiment.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) of 62.98 implies that the stock is approaching overbought territory, warranting cautious optimism from technical traders.

As Tempus AI continues to innovate and expand its offerings, it remains a promising, albeit speculative, investment. Its strategic collaborations and cutting-edge technology could yield significant returns, but investors must weigh these opportunities against the company’s current financial challenges. For those with a higher risk tolerance and a focus on long-term growth, Tempus AI presents an intriguing opportunity in the healthcare technology sector.
